Description
- Alexis Paul Arapoff
- Moored Boats
- signed in Latin and dated 28 l.l.
- oil on canvas
- 60 by 73cm, 23 1/2 by 28 3/4 in.
Condition
Original canvas which is buckling slightly in the lower left corner. There is a patch on the reverse. The tacking edges have been taped and a strip of paper is visible along right side of the top edge. There are frame abrasions with minor associated paint loss along all four edges. There is a pattern of craquelure visible in several areas throughout the composition, notably to the areas with impasto. There are scattered flecks of paint loss and surface scratches. The surface is covered in a layer of dirt with spots in places. Inspection under UV light reveals retouching to an area just below the second boat from the left which corresponds to the aforementioned patch, retouching to the sky and to the lower left corner as well as further minor spots elsewhere. Held in a gilt wooden frame with mouldings. Unexamined out of frame.
